Audit: State overpaid health care providers pandemic relief

The state of Vermont overpaid 17 health care providers by a total of $7 million in federal COVID-19 relief money through a state grant program set up to offset pandemic-related revenue losses in the industry, according to a report from the Vermont state auditor.
